Tinubu Orders Review Of Road Safety Protocols After Fatal Abuja Explosion

President Bola Tinubu has directed a thorough investigation into the tanker explosion that resulted in multiple accidents and loss of lives in Karu area of Abuja, on Wednesday evening.

The President, in a statement by his spokesman, Bayo Onanuga, condoled with family members who lost loved ones in the inferno, which happened at the peak hour.

President Tinubu ordered priority treatment of the injured in various medical facilities in the capital city.

The President also directed security agencies, particularly those concerned with road safety, to pay closer attention to traffic around the capital city’s entry and exit points.

Tinubu prayed for the souls of the departed and the grace of the Almighty God to comfort families that have lost their loved ones.
